Producing Energy from Vibrations

Hypothetically, all vibration energy can be transformed into electrical energy; but there are certain types of vibrations that are preferred when the intent is to power a sensor or monitoring system. These vibrations need to have a steady vibration and a controlling frequency.

How Silicon Carbide is Changing Solar Power Systems

Silicon carbide enables solar inverters to be lighter, smaller and more efficient. Using silicon carbide power components instead of silicon for solar inverters can save 10 megawatts for each gigawatt and 500 watts/sec in operations, representing significant energy savings.

Automatic Charging of EVs

Charging stations can be an eyesore in inner cities, and the bulky cables and plugs can also be an inconvenience in people's garages. Contactless inductive charging with coils embedded in the garage floor or the road surface has none of these visual or mechanical annoyances.

NREL Six-Junction Solar Cell Sets Two World Records for Efficiency

The six-junction solar cell now holds the world record for the highest solar conversion efficiency at 47.1%, which was measured under concentrated illumination. A variation of the same cell also set the efficiency record under one-sun illumination at 39.2%.
